Metabolic Transcription Factors Mediate Conserved Functions Largely via Species-Specific Binding Regions

Mus musculus, Homo sapiens

The winged helix protein FOXA2 and the nuclear receptor PPARg are highly conserved, regionally-expressed transcription factors that regulate networks of genes controlling complex metabolic functions. Cistrome analysis for FOXA2 in mouse liver and PPARg in …

Type: Genome binding/occupancy profiling by high throughput sequencing
